We asked Hen Night HQ visitors for their top hen night tips - and this is what they said!
At least one person should remain sober, that way everyone remains a little safer.

Chill out, drink in moderation
Don't do what everyone else did just because...pick something that YOU want to do!
Enjoy and don't worry about everyone else having fun - it's your night!
Find time for photos – just make sure they're not too incriminating!
Go to an Australian bar - no problem finding volunteers to help with forfeits!
Have the hen night at least 2 weeks before wedding to allow time to recover
Invite your crazy friends – that way you're bound to have a wild time
Just go for it - hopefully it will be the only one you have
Keep it simple
Look out for each other
Make sure you have a kitty to cover any essentials and prevent arguments
Not toooo much drink
Order taxis in advance
Play plenty of party games or set some dares
Quirky activities such as pole dancing classes or pottery painting are a nice alternative to pubs and clubs
Remember why you're getting married - behave
Start with a bit of cheesy music
Try to introduce and include everyone. Early bit of the night that's suitable for mums, and then something a bit wilder later on.
Understand that your mum or mother-in-law might not appreciate an invite to a strip club. Consider joining them for a sedate meal instead.
Veils aren't just for the wedding – wear one on your hen night to help secure free drinks
What happens at the party stays at the party!
X-rated antics should only be entered in to if you're 100% sober and 110% sure
You don't need to travel far to have a good time - being with all your mates is what counts
Zany costumes and themes get everyone in the mood and help the group to bond
